What your role will be

Onboarding

  • Manage the end-to-end onboarding process ensuring a smooth compliant and engaging experience for new hires.
  • Serve as the main point of contact for new employees from offer acceptance through their first day and beyond.
  • Coordinate onboarding activities with recruiters HR business partners hiring managers IT and other stakeholders (documentation system access inductions).
  • Deliver and support onboarding presentations and orientation sessions both virtually and in person.
  • Maintain accurate onboarding records and prepare reports using Excel and other MS Office tools.
  • Ensure compliance with internal policies data privacy standards and local employment regulations.
  • Coordinate background checks offer documentation and other pre-employment activities.
  • Align onboarding timelines with recruitment activities to ensure seamless transitions.

Recruitment Operations Support

  • Collaborate with HR and Centers of Excellence (COEs) to improve document and standardize recruitment processes and workflows.
  • Promote consistent use of recruitment systems tools and templates collecting feedback and driving continuous improvement.
  • Support recruitment-related projects such as system upgrades process audits and vendor transitions.
  • Manage recruitment and onboarding-related HR service tickets ensuring timely resolution and proper escalation when needed.
  • Contribute to global knowledge sharing by maintaining recruiting toolkits and communicating updates via SharePoint and MS Teams.
  • Monitor SLAs KPIs and candidate/hiring manager experience metrics.
  • Provide administrative support for recruitment reporting dashboarding and data validation.
  • Offer ad hoc support during peak periods including interview scheduling candidate communications and recruitment events.
